Staff Manager Dialog

Command Location: Staves Menu

The Staff Manager displays information about all the staves in the score and allows you to:

  1. change the underlying MIDI properties of each staff in the score,
  2. alter the staff display and playback features,
  3. edit the staff namings, and
  4. reorder, add, copy and remove staves.

The Staff Manager dialog is made up of three tabs (MIDI Configuration, Display and Playback and Staff Namings) and a Staff Display Window. The window lists each of the staves contained within the MIDI file and displays their details.

Apply/Apply Now The Apply button applies all of the changes made to the staff/staves without the need to close the dialog box by hitting the OK button.  E.g. If you hide a selected staff and rearrange the order of the remaining staves these changes will not be reflected on the score until you press the Apply button.

If you would like your changes to be made immediately use The Apply Now button. When this button is used any changes made to the staves will be reflected on the score straightaway, without the need to click the Apply button.

The buttons on the left-hand side of the window can be used to edit selected staves, either individually or in groups (simply hold down the shift key as you select the staves for your group).

In addition, within the Staff Display Window, the following buttons may be used to hide or to mute selected staves.

Using the check box columns marked overhead with a cross (x) and a speaker, selected staves can be hidden/shown and muted/unmuted. The first column is the hide/show function and the second the mute function.
